"The hip bone's connected to the backbone..." Sing along to the skeleton song, and you'll know some of this discipline that studies bones.
Answer Osteology
Combining anatomy, paleontology, and anthropology, the study of bones and their structure includes disease, pathology, and function. Osteologists can work anywhere, from museums to research labs, and may even serve as expert witnesses in criminal investigations.
